Re: Operating temperatures for Rotax 912 ULS

This Sunday I was flying in my Sting with OAT being close to 70 .
A longish climb out resulted in around 215F CHT , later stabilizing to about 205F or so.

This is all normal for me since I start noticing CHTs in yellow and need to start managing my climb outs somewhere above 85F OAT.
